React与交通咨询系统的动态视图
发布时间: 2024-03-29 03:25:10 阅读量: 34 订阅数: 45
# 1. 简介
### 1.1 交通咨询系统的意义和需求
交通咨询系统在现代社会中扮演着重要角色,帮助人们获取实时的交通信息,提供路况、交通事故等相关信息,帮助用户做出更好的出行决策。在大城市中,交通咨询系统更是必不可少的工具,不仅可以提高出行便利性,还能有效缓解交通拥堵问题。
### 1.2 React在动态视图中的应用背景
React作为一款流行的前端框架,以其组件化、虚拟DOM等特点在动态视图的构建中有着广泛的应用。在交通咨询系统中,实时更新的交通信息需要以动态的方式展示给用户,这时候React的快速渲染和高效更新能够带来更好的用户体验。
# 2. React框架简介
- 2.1 React核心概念回顾
- 2.1 React组件模块化设计
- 2.3 React虚拟DOM原理
# 3. 交通咨询系统架构设计
在设计交通咨询系统的架构时,需要考虑系统的功能需求、前端与后端交互架构以及数据流动设计与状态管理等方面。下面将对这些内容进行详细讨论。
#### 3.1 系统功能需求分析
在交通咨询系统中,用户需要获取实时的交通信息,包括路况、交通事件等。因此,系统需要实现实时更新功能,同时也要能够提供历史数据查询的能力。另外,用户还需要进行定制化设置,比如选择关注的路段、接收通知等。
#### 3.2 前端与后端交互架构
前端与后端的交互是交通咨询系统设计中至关重要的一环。前端可以通过RESTful API与后端进行数据交换,从而实现数据的获取和展示。后端
0
0